Credit Union Employment Resources is working with a credit union in Oklahoma City in their search for an experienced Chief Financial Officer. This experienced financial executive will manage and direct all aspects of the Accounting & Financial area including all management/supervisory functions in the Accounting department, as well as financial analyses of operations. Ensures that all records of the credit union, as they pertain to the accounting department, are accurate an in adherence to rules and regulations as set forth for by NCUA
